After decades of relentless growth, global cities face dramatic upheaval as new technology and Covid-19 change the way we live and work. Our Future Cities Series asks: what now for one of the prime engines of the modern economy?
By 2050, urban living is set to cover over two-thirds of global population thanks to explosive growth in cities. Yet metropolitan areas have been savaged by the pandemic, with Covid-19 spreading quickly in densely populated regions, while lockdowns and social distancing have questioned cornerstones of city life: interaction, convenience and vitality among them.
History tells us that cities will quickly adapt to such pressures, reflecting their potent social and economic role in modern life. But what will such rapid change to their social, technological and environmental demands look like?
